One of the things I'm curious about is how the HONDA badges are fixed.

The manual and parts diagrams make reference to clips such as the following...

[ Guests cannot view attachments ]

My question is will these just pull off if pulled in the right place and are they reusable or are new ones always required? Is it possible the badges could be fixed in some other way such as self adhesive?

Those clips push into holes on brackets recessed in the tank then pins on the back of the badges push into the clips, using something flat, thin and stiff between the back of the badge and the tank you lever the badges outwards till free of the clips. Sometimes the clips come out as well, they always need removing from the tank for repaint but are normally reusable except for the fact they are so small they get lost easily!
